Flaxseed flatbread

Gluten-free wholesome alternative to toast

Ingredients

1.5 ground flaxseeds

½ tsp garlic powder

½ tsp onion powder

½ tsp paprika

Pinch of sea salt, thyme, black pepper

1 cup boiling water

Method

In a large mixing bowl, combine the ground flaxseeds and seasoning.

In parallel, boil the water.

As soon as it’s boiling, remove from heat and add the ground flaxseeds to the saucepan.

Using a wooden spoon, stir until it forms a ball. Let the dough cool for 2-3 minutes in the saucepan.

Divide the dough into 4 balls. Place each ball on a parchment paper. Top with another sheet of parchment paper and roll out the dough into a thin wrap.

Heat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at. Once hot, cook the flaxseed wrap for about 1 minute on each side. Repeat with the other wraps.
